skrev:Colours are more vibrant, detail is clearer and in abundance. Skintones are truer, blood is redder, cuts are deeper and there is a distinct lack of noise or dirt.
As far as the subtitles are concerned these are new and make the films much easier to understand. You can consider the old subtitles in earlier issues of the film to be at best wrong or at worst crap and misleading.
In particular in the first film Sword of Vengeance if you did not understand why Lone Wolf went to the Hot Springs village overrun by bandit ronin in the second part of the film, this is now clear in the new subtitles.
Although there are no extras apart from trailers I consider the pruchase of this new box set, officially issued by Toho and Eureka to be the best versions of the films yet.
